Understanding the LMD18200 Architecture

The LMD18200 is a 3A, 55V H-bridge designed for motion control. Unlike smaller drivers, it have intragroup thermal security and short-circuit security, which are life-sustaining when working with motors that can produce orotund inductive spike. The nucleus architecture swear on an H-bridge configuration, allow you to flip the polarity of the voltage supplied to the motor pole, effectively enabling both onward and setback revolution.

Interfacing the Driver with Microcontrollers

To establish a functional Lmd18200 Arduino frame-up, you must centre on the input pins: Direction, PWM (Pulse Width Modulation), and Brake. The Arduino's digital output pins act as the bid center, post eminent or low signaling to influence the motor's province, while the PWM pin regulates the potential norm to control speed.

Pin Gens Use Arduino Connector
DIR Set rotation way Digital Pin
PWM Controls motor speeding PWM Pin
BRACKEN Strength immediate stop Digital Pin
VS Provision Voltage External Power Source

When wiring, ensure that you percentage a mutual earth between the international power supply and the Arduino. Failing to associate grounds ofttimes guide to erratic behavior or consummate failure of signal transmission between the two device.

⚠️ Note: Always use an external power provision for the motor. Ne'er attempt to ability a motor immediately from the 5V pin of your development plank, as the current spike can permanently damage your hardware.

Advanced PWM Control Techniques

One of the primary reasons to utilise the LMD18200 is its ability to handle high-frequency PWM. By utilizing theanalogWrite()use on supported pins, you can achieve smooth speedup and retardation. If your motor exhibits a high-pitched whimper, consider conform the timekeeper frequence of your microcontroller pins. High frequency frequently result in quieter motor operation at the cost of slight increases in exchange losses within the H-bridge.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

If you see issue where the motor does not become, control the chase:

  • Insure if the Enable pin (if applicable to your faculty) is driven eminent.
  • Ensure the extraneous ability supply is change on and ply the correct potential.
  • Inspect the logic pins for loose connecter.
  • Verify the thermal condition; if the driver is too hot, it will automatically disable yield.

💡 Tone: Installing a heatsink on the LMD18200 is highly recommended if you plan on driving gobs near the 3A limit for run periods to preclude thermal throttling.
